Ilmamatalajännitejohtimia, also known as low-voltage overhead conductors, are a critical component of electrical distribution networks. These conductors are used to transmit electricity at lower voltage levels from substations to individual consumers, such as homes and businesses. Unlike high-voltage lines which are typically found in transmission networks, low-voltage conductors operate at voltages suitable for direct use by end-users, usually below 1000 volts.
